What is the difference between an agreement and a judgement?

The difference between a settlement and verdict is that a settlement involves an agreement between the plaintiff and company to settle the lawsuit. It can happen before or after the trial. On the other hand, a jury's verdict is a decision about how much an asbestos business owes a victim for their mesothelioma or lung cancer diagnosis. The outcome of a trial can be unpredictable because juries are usually pro-company. The majority of mesothelioma cases settle instead of going to trial.

Asbestos victims may also be eligible for settlements through asbestos trust funds. These trusts were created to pay victims affected by asbestos even if the asbestos manufacturer went into bankruptcy. Asbestos victims might find that trust fund payouts are higher than traditional settlements.
